86 JYB is a 2002 Audi Tt in Silver with a 1,800cc petrol engine. This vehicle has been through 24 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 70.8%.
Across all 2002 Audi Tt models, the average MOT pass rate is 69.9% with a typical mileage of 84,577 miles. This particular vehicle has performed better than the average for its year.
The most common reason a Audi Tt fails its MOT is tyre tread depth below requirements of 1.6mm, accounting for 59,061 recorded failures. If you're considering buying 86 JYB,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.
The Audi Tt typically stays on UK roads for around 27 years. At 24 years old, this Audi Tt is approaching the upper end of the typical lifespan for this model.
